Understanding Educational Psychology
Educational psychology sits at the crossroads of psychology, sociology, and pedagogy. Its primary aim is to decipher how people learn, what motivates them, and which environmental factors shape academic success. By reviewing seminal research—such as Vygotsky’s sociocultural theory, Piaget’s stages of development, and Bandura’s social learning framework—teachers gain a lens through which to interpret classroom dynamics.
One of the most powerful concepts is the zone of proximal development (ZPD), which describes the gap between what a learner can achieve independently and what they can accomplish with appropriate scaffolding. Recognizing each student’s ZPD enables teachers to design differentiated tasks that are challenging yet achievable, thus promoting mastery without causing frustration.
Another cornerstone is the idea of self‑efficacy. When learners believe they can succeed, they are more likely to persist, employ effective strategies, and achieve higher outcomes. Teachers can nurture self‑efficacy by providing clear success criteria, offering timely feedback, and celebrating incremental progress.

Key Theories in Classroom Settings
Beyond the overarching framework, several specific theories have direct implications for lesson planning and classroom management.
- Behaviorism – Emphasizes observable behavior and the role of reinforcement. Using positive reinforcement (praise, tokens, or privileges) can shape desired academic behaviors while minimizing disruptive actions.
- Constructivism – Argues that learners build knowledge actively. Strategies like inquiry‑based learning, problem‑solving tasks, and concept mapping encourage students to construct meaning rather than passively receive information.
- Social Learning Theory – Highlights the impact of modeling and observation. Teachers who demonstrate intellectual curiosity, collaborative habits, and respectful communication provide powerful role models for students.
By marrying these theories, teachers can create a balanced instructional climate that simultaneously rewards effort, fosters deep understanding, and leverages peer influence for positive outcomes.
Applying Cognitive Development Principles
Understanding the stages of Cognitive Development equips teachers with age‑appropriate expectations. For example, younger learners (pre‑operational stage) benefit from concrete, hands‑on activities, while adolescents (formal operational stage) thrive on abstract reasoning and hypothetical discussions.
Practical applications include:
- Chunking Information – Break complex concepts into manageable units. This aligns with working‑memory limitations identified in cognitive research.
- Dual Coding – Pair verbal explanations with visual representations. Combining text, diagrams, and gestures enhances retention.
- Spaced Retrieval – Distribute review sessions over time rather than cramming. Spacing strengthens long‑term memory consolidation.
- Metacognitive Prompts – Encourage students to reflect on how they learn (“What strategy helped you solve this problem?”). Metacognition promotes self‑regulation and deeper learning.
When teachers align instruction with developmental readiness, they reduce cognitive overload and maximize engagement.
Assessment and Feedback Strategies
Effective assessment is more than grading; it is a diagnostic tool that informs instruction. Formative assessments—quick checks, exit tickets, or think‑pair‑share activities—provide immediate data on student understanding, allowing teachers to adjust pacing in real time.
Feedback should be:
- Specific – Point to exact strengths and areas for improvement.
- Timely – Delivered while the task is fresh in the learner’s mind.
- Goal‑Oriented – Linked to learning objectives, not just overall performance.
- Growth‑Focused – Emphasize effort, strategy use, and progress rather than innate ability.
Incorporating peer review also taps into social learning principles, as students gain perspective on their work while practicing critical evaluation skills.
Professional Growth and Collaboration
Teachers who embrace educational psychology fundamentals view professional development as an ongoing inquiry. Collaborative learning communities, lesson study groups, and reflective practice journals foster a culture of shared expertise.
Key steps for continuous growth include:
- Data‑Driven Reflection – Regularly analyze student performance data in light of psychological theory.
- Peer Observation – Invite colleagues to observe and provide feedback focused on instructional alignment with psychological principles.
- Professional Learning Networks – Participate in online forums, webinars, and conferences that discuss recent research in educational psychology.
- Action Research – Conduct small‑scale studies in your classroom, test hypotheses about teaching strategies, and disseminate findings.
These practices not only improve individual teaching effectiveness but also elevate the collective expertise of the school community.

Comparison Table: Traditional vs. Psychologically Informed Approaches
| Aspect | Traditional Teaching | Psychologically Informed Teaching |
|---|---|---|
| Lesson Design | Content‑first, teacher‑centered delivery. | Learning‑goal oriented, student‑centered activities aligned with developmental stages. |
| Classroom Management | Rule‑based, punitive consequences. | Positive reinforcement, scaffolding, and self‑regulation strategies. |
| Assessment | Summative exams dominate. | Formative checks, feedback loops, and metacognitive prompts. |
| Student Motivation | Extrinsic rewards (grades, stickers). | Intrinsic motivation through self‑efficacy and relevance. |
| Professional Development | One‑off workshops. | Continuous inquiry, peer observation, and action research. |
